Coaching Assignment: List 20 things that you like about yourself. Don’t judge or second guess, they can be anything no matter how big or small! Next, make a list of 20 things you desire in a relationship. Get specific and don’t be afraid to claim exactly what you want. Take some time to combine these two lists to create an affirmation, using the following statement: I desire, want, and deserve (something from your relationship list) because I like and value (something from the list of things you like about yourself)____. For example; I desire, want, and deserve a relationship with mutual respect because I like and value the way I always try to listen to and understand others.
